Open Python ver. 3.6 from cmd line on Windows
If you want to open up Python ver. 3.6 or any other versions from command line on Windows system. Do the following:
👀
If you have a different version of python install, just replace 3.6 with that version.

- Go to Start menu > type cmd in the search box>Press ENTER
- In the command prompt type py -3.6
- Press ENTER

Using environment from YAML file in Andconda command prompt (Windows)
This post is to help me remember how to create an enviroment using YAML file using Anaconda command prompt in Windows 10.
Step1: Save the YAML file to the Anaconda envs folder to your computer.
C:\Users\avi\Anaconda3\envs
In this example I have saved the file name dand-env-win.yaml
![]() |
| dand-env-win.yaml |
Step 2: Open Anaconda commant prompt and type conda create -n dand-env-win
the file will be saved to C:\Users\avi\Anaconda3\envs path
Type y to proceed
Step 3: To active the environment type activate dand-env-win
Now, we can go ahead and install any required packages, they will be installed to this environment, by using the following command conda install python=2.7 (or python=3) pandas numpy matplotlib seaborn
Type y to proceed
